Wedding Night

I look at her and I see
Such beauty that thrills me
So lovely and full of grace
She turns all heads in this place

In love side by side
I'm her husband and she's my bride
No words need to be said
Hand in hand we go to our bed

I pull her close and we feel
Our love so true, so strong, so real
Tonight feels like our wedding night
After fifty two years our love feels so right
